Figure skating: Arakawa 1st, Asada 3rd after SP at national c'ships
December 24, 2005Former world champion Shizuka Arakawa skated flawlessly to take the lead after the women's short program Saturday at the figure skating national championships, while teenage sensation Mao Asada took third. Aiming for her first Olympic appearance since 1998, Arakawa collected 68.76 points at Yoyogi national gymnasium to take first place ahead of Fumie Suguri, who earned 67.30. Asada, who at 15 is ineligible to skate in the Turin Olympics in February, got 66.64 after her planned double axel ended up as a single axel.
